Instructions:    

	Copy all files to your FS subdirectory.  Switch to your FS
subdirectory and enter AUTOFIX SD-3.SCN at the DOS prompt.  AUTOFIX
will then remove the old runways at Riverside Muni.  Start FS in the 
usual manner and select option "J" (Scenery Designer).  Select 
Options from the menu and set both static and dynamic scenery memory 
allocations to at least 18000.

Features:

RIVERSIDE MUNICIPAL AIRPORT - RAL   

	Airport Coordinates:  15288.3975N  6138.4128E  816 ft  MSL
         Tower Coordinates:  15288.0320N  6139.5538E  846 ft. MSL
          Pattern Altitude:  1816 feet MSL (1000 ft. AGL)
            
          Rwy 9/27  5,400 x 100 ft.  Alt. 758/816 ft.

               1. Paved and lighted
               2. VASI & REIL on Rwy 27
               3. MALS & ILS (freq. 110.9) on Rwy 9
               4. Rwy 9/27 slops downhill towards the west

          Rwy 16/34  2,850 x  50 ft.  Alt. 748/772 ft.

               1. Paved and lighted/Right traffic Rwy 16
               2. Displaced threshold (indicated by white             
                  ploygons) on Rwy 34 (2,270 ft.) is available for
			   landing.
               3. Much of Rwy 34 is not visible from the Tower

    	MISC NOTE:  Riverside VOR (112.4) has been re-located to it's
 	correct location on the field SW of where the runways cross.
                         

FLABOB AIRPORT - RIR  (located 3 nmi NNE of RAL)
			
	Airport Coordinates: 15299.0425N  6166.2459E  Alt. 764 ft. MSL 
        Pattern Altitude: 1364 ft. MSL (600 ft. AGL)

	Runways:  6/24 3,200 x 50 ft. 

		1.  Paved and lighted 
		2.  Displaced threshold on rwy 24 (3,050 ft. available).
		3.  Mountain (1340 ft. MSL) 3/4 mi. SE of runway. Look for
 		    stray dogs on runway.
		4.  Landfill 1 mi. S with numerous birds.

	
CORONA MUNICIPAL AIRPORT - L66  (located 9 nmi SW of RAL)

	Airport Coordinates:  15280.4245N  6080.4912E  Alt. 533 ft. MSL
        Pattern Altitude:  1533 ft. MSL  (1000 AGL)

	Runways:  7/25  3,200 x 60 ft.

		1.  Paved and Lighted
		2.  VASI & REIL on Rwy 25
		3.  Displaced thresholds on both runways
		 	 (3,000 ft. available)
		4.  Rwy 7 requires a 15 degree right turn at departure to
 			follow creek (not shown).
		5.  Departing Rwy 25 avoid flying over homes east of airport 
			(not shown).
		6.  Heliocopter activity south of field to 500 ft.


STATIC SCENERY
	
	All (or mostly all) airport buildings are depicted.  Several
building in beautiful downtown Riverside as well (County Admin Blg., 
City Hall, County Courthouse and the famous Mission Inn).  My home 
(single building near Mt. Blue NE of Fwy 91/60 interchange).  
Riverside County Hospital S of RAL.  California Baptist College SSE of 
RAL.  University of California, Riverside due E  of Mt. Rubdioux 
opposite the 91 fwy.

	Evans Lake is located NE of Mt. Rubidoux and Lake Mathews SE of 
RAL.  The Santa Ana River is shown between the 60 Fwy and Corona. 
Local Foothills depicted include Mt. Rubidoux (1339 ft.), Mt. 
Sugerloaf (1945 ft.) N of UCR, Coyote Hill (1547 ft.) S of UCR, Box 
Springs Mt. (3168 ft>) NE of UCR and Blue Mt. (2414 ft.).

State Hwy 91 is now complete between Corona and Riverside.  The gap in 
Sate Hwy 60 is also filled.  Numerous local streets are depicted.	

DYNAMIC SCENERY

Includes a Lear jet flying the pattern at RAL and a Cessna taking off 
from RAL, doing a (sloppy) touch `n go at FLABOB then returning to 
RAL.
